Compare all specifications:
2004 Chevrolet Corvette | 2001 Toyota Camry | |
Make | Chevrolet | Toyota |
Model | Corvette | Camry |
Year Released | 2004 | 2001 |
Body Type | Convertible | Sedan |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 5736 cc | 2362 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 8 cylinders | 4 cylinders |
Engine Type | V | in-line |
Horse Power | 350 HP | 157 HP |
Engine RPM | 5600 RPM | 6500 RPM |
Torque | 488 Nm | 220 Nm |
Engine Bore Size | 99 mm | 88.5 mm |
Engine Stroke Size | 92 mm | 96 mm |
Engine Compression Ratio | 10.1:1 | 9.6:1 |
Drive Type | Rear | Front |
Number of Seats | 2 seats | 5 seats |
Number of Doors | 2 doors | 4 doors |
Vehicle Weight | 1515 kg | 1420 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4570 mm | 4820 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1880 mm | 1800 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1220 mm | 1500 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2630 mm | 2730 mm |
Fuel Tank Capacity | 68 L | 70 L |
